Meaning of "i had trouble"
This phrase is used to express difficulty or challenges that someone has experienced. It indicates that the speaker encountered problems or obstacles while attempting to accomplish a task or solve a problem. It suggests that the individual faced difficulties that required effort, perseverance, or assistance to overcome. This phrase can be used to describe a wide range of situations where someone has encountered difficulty or encountered unexpected challenges
